Operational admin

Board Game Station

Admin login

Access control

Foundation for platform roles and the audit log. Access must be enforced in Supabase before any sensitive action.

Active members

0

admin roles currently enabled

Platform admins

0

users allowed to grant or revoke access

Revoked

0

historical access records retained for audit

Audit events

0

sensitive admin actions loaded

V1 Roles

Operational roles stored in Supabase and enforced server-side.

platform_admin0

Manages admin access, critical overrides, and global audit.

moderator0

Handles publications, reports, and moderation decisions.

translator0

Validates, locks, and marks translations as outdated.

support_agent0

Handles tickets, support messages, and user escalations.

billing_operator0

Controls subscriptions, entitlements, and billing overrides.

Permission Matrix

Human-readable map for deciding which role to grant.

platform_admin

All admin modules, access grants, security overrides.

moderator

Moderation queue, reports, media review, advertising review.

translator

Translation proposals, language review, translation validation.

support_agent

Support tickets, user assistance, report handoff context.

billing_operator

Billing documents, payouts, orders, subscription operations.

Server-side Enforcement

Access screens are only a control surface. Sensitive permissions must remain enforced in Supabase and server actions.

`platform_admin_members` stores role assignments.
`current_user_has_platform_role` gates privileged reads.
Server actions require explicit roles before writes.
`admin_audit_log` records sensitive changes.

Admin login required

Admin login required before reading operational data.

Admin login required

Admin login required before reading operational data.

Access Filters

0 of 0 access records and 0 of 0 audit events match the current filters.

Reset

Platform admin members

0 active or revoked admin roles match the current filters.

Admin login required

Admin login required before reading operational data.

No data to display.

Admin audit log

0 sensitive admin actions match the current filters.

Admin login required

Admin login required before reading operational data.

No data to display.